Advantages of Ball Screw Linear Modules
Modern Ball Screw Linear Modules provide exceptional motion accuracy. The ball screw mechanism minimizes friction while improving positioning precision. Precision automation systems frequently incorporate these components in CNC machinery, semiconductor production, electronics manufacturing, robotic systems, laboratory automation, and precision assembly equipment. Precision engineering contributes to consistent manufacturing quality.
Industrial Belt Guide Rail Drive Module
Modern belt-driven guide rail modules provide efficient long-travel motion. Belt drive technology supports continuous production environments. Automation engineers rely on these systems in packaging equipment, automated warehouses, conveyor systems, assembly lines, logistics automation, and robotic handling equipment. Durable construction supports long-term industrial use.
